-- File: DimensionalExponents.cdl
|
|
-- Created: Fri Dec 1 11:11:19 1995
|
|
-- Author: EXPRESS->CDL V0.2 Translator
|
|
-- Copyright: Matra-Datavision 1993
|
|
|
|
|
|
class DimensionalExponents from StepBasic
|
|
|
|
inherits TShared from MMgt
|
|
|
|
uses
|
|
|
|
Real from Standard
|
|
is
|
|
|
|
Create returns mutable DimensionalExponents;
|
|
---Purpose: Returns a DimensionalExponents
|
|
|
|
Init (me : mutable;
|
|
aLengthExponent : Real from Standard;
|
|
aMassExponent : Real from Standard;
|
|
aTimeExponent : Real from Standard;
|
|
aElectricCurrentExponent : Real from Standard;
|
|
aThermodynamicTemperatureExponent : Real from Standard;
|
|
aAmountOfSubstanceExponent : Real from Standard;
|
|
aLuminousIntensityExponent : Real from Standard) is virtual;
|
|
|
|
-- Specific Methods for Field Data Access --
|
|
|
|
SetLengthExponent(me : mutable; aLengthExponent : Real);
|
|
LengthExponent (me) returns Real;
|
|
SetMassExponent(me : mutable; aMassExponent : Real);
|
|
MassExponent (me) returns Real;
|
|
SetTimeExponent(me : mutable; aTimeExponent : Real);
|
|
TimeExponent (me) returns Real;
|
|
SetElectricCurrentExponent(me : mutable; aElectricCurrentExponent : Real);
|
|
ElectricCurrentExponent (me) returns Real;
|
|
SetThermodynamicTemperatureExponent(me : mutable; aThermodynamicTemperatureExponent : Real);
|
|
ThermodynamicTemperatureExponent (me) returns Real;
|
|
SetAmountOfSubstanceExponent(me : mutable; aAmountOfSubstanceExponent : Real);
|
|
AmountOfSubstanceExponent (me) returns Real;
|
|
SetLuminousIntensityExponent(me : mutable; aLuminousIntensityExponent : Real);
|
|
LuminousIntensityExponent (me) returns Real;
|
|
|
|
fields
|
|
|
|
lengthExponent : Real from Standard;
|
|
massExponent : Real from Standard;
|
|
timeExponent : Real from Standard;
|
|
electricCurrentExponent : Real from Standard;
|
|
thermodynamicTemperatureExponent : Real from Standard;
|
|
amountOfSubstanceExponent : Real from Standard;
|
|
luminousIntensityExponent : Real from Standard;
|
|
|
|
end DimensionalExponents;
